Study On Chemical Constituents Of Tilia Mongolica Bark Ethyl Acetate Extract

Tilia Mongolica Maxim, is a member of Tiliaceae family. Its bark, leave and flower were utilized for treatment of many disease. Recently, it was reported that T. Mongolica has inhibiting effect to Anoplophora glabripennis.In present study, by extracting the bark of T. Mongolica using a series of organic solvents respectively, different kinds of extracts were obtained. Six compounds were isolated from the ethyl acetate extracts by utilizing column chromatography, preparative TLC and recrystallization techniques. The complete structures of compounds were identified by IR, 1D and 2D NMR( 1H NMR, 13C NMR, DEPT, HMQC, HMBC, 1h,1H-COSY) data and literatures. They are β -amyrin acetate( Ⅰ ), germanicol acetate ( Ⅱ ), lupeol ( Ⅲ ), propane-1,2,3-triyl tripalmitate (Ⅳ), daucosterol( Ⅴ ) and 3-D thymidine 3' ,5' -di (4- chlorobenzoate)( Ⅵ). Among them, Ⅱ, Ⅲ, Ⅳ and Ⅴ are known compounds isolated from the genus for the first time.
